2:8-23. DOCTRINAL CORRECTION.
D  c  2:8. Caution. Let no man deceive you.
    d  2:9,10. Christ the Head, and the body complete in Him.
     e  2:11-15. Ordinances therefore done away in Christ.
   c  2:16-18. Caution. Let no man judge you.
    d  2:19. Christ the Head, and the body nourished by Him.
     e  2:20-23. Ordinances therefore done away in Christ.
